Renal Artery
The blood vessels that supply the kidneys with blood rich in oxygen and nutrients.
Renal Vein
A blood vessel that carries filtered blood away from the kidney to the inferior vena cava.
Kidney
A pair of organs located in the abdominal cavity responsible for filtering blood, removing waste, and balancing bodily fluids.
Kidney
A vital organ in the body responsible for filtering waste from the blood, regulating blood pressure, and balancing fluids and electrolytes.
